5.1. Pricing Model: Use of the API is subject to fees based on the number of active End Users associated with your account's usage of the API. Unless otherwise agreed in a separate written agreement, the standard fee is $1.00 CAD per active End User per month.
5.2. Definition of Active End User: An "active End User" is defined as any unique End User ID that makes network 302 100 registration within a given monthly billing period. Data On Tap reserves the right to modify this definition with prior notice.
5.3. Billing and Invoicing: You will be billed monthly in arrears based on your API usage, specifically the aggregate number of active End Users detected within the preceding billing cycle. Invoices will be issued monthly and are due and payable within thirty (30) days of the invoice date.
5.4. Late Payments: Data On Tap reserves the right to suspend or terminate your access to the API for overdue payments. Late payments may incur interest at a rate of 1.5% per month (18% per annum) or the maximum rate permitted by law, whichever is lower, calculated from the due date until paid in full.
5.5. Taxes: All fees are exclusive of any applicable taxes, duties, or levies (including, but not limited to, sales, use, excise, VAT, and withholding taxes), which shall be your sole responsibility.
